Face to Face visits provide an opportunity for guardianship staff to:

  • Assess health, safety and welfare (HSW) of individuals under guardianship.
  • Build positive working relationships with individuals.
  • Discuss and determine an individual’s desires, goals, and preferences.
  • Determine and address unmet needs.
  • Gather and document pertinent facts to ensure continuity of care and services.
